< prev index next >
src/hotspot/cpu/aarch64/macroAssembler_aarch64.cpp
Print this page
*** 3982,4001 ****
narrowKlass nk = Klass::encode_klass(k);
movz(dst, (nk >> 16), 16);
movk(dst, nk & 0xffff);
}
- void MacroAssembler::resolve_for_read(DecoratorSet decorators, Register obj) {
- BarrierSetAssembler* bs = BarrierSet::barrier_set()->barrier_set_assembler();
- bs->resolve_for_read(this, decorators, obj);
- }
-
- void MacroAssembler::resolve_for_write(DecoratorSet decorators, Register obj) {
- BarrierSetAssembler* bs = BarrierSet::barrier_set()->barrier_set_assembler();
- bs->resolve_for_write(this, decorators, obj);
- }
-
void MacroAssembler::access_load_at(BasicType type, DecoratorSet decorators,
Register dst, Address src,
Register tmp1, Register thread_tmp) {
BarrierSetAssembler *bs = BarrierSet::barrier_set()->barrier_set_assembler();
decorators = AccessInternal::decorator_fixup(decorators);
--- 3982,3991 ----
< prev index next >